                                                            <content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Andie introduces Spiral Tending Podcast and invites healers into the Spiral Collective, a community to move away from performance pressure, “bullshit professionalism,” and small business isolation while discussing themes like money, restructuring in late-stage capitalism, and mutual support. Andie interviews Heather Bax of Small Business Rodeo, who helps small business owners “wrangle their work and find their flow” through strategy and systems so they can reduce overwhelm and run confident experiments. Heather shares a circuitous path—dog training, web development, and opening a North Carolina gift shop in 2019 that survived COVID through an online store, gift certificate sales, and hiring staff—amid her father’s sudden death and ongoing stress. She reflects on grief as clarifying and creativity-opening, the myth of “arriving” after burnout, and critiques one-size-fits-all online business coaching. Her key advice is that clarity is a prerequisite for discernment. Heather directs listeners to smallbusiness.rodeo and a free tech stack guide.<em><br>

How do we hold intuitive eating &amp; GLP-1? How has accepting insurance supported your financial well-being and nervous system? What stories do we tell ourselves from scrolling insta?
 
Leah Kern is an Anti-Diet Dietitian and Certified Intuitive Eating Counselor who helps people make peace with food and body using the Health At Every Size (HAES) and Intuitive Eating frameworks. Upon earning her RDN, Leah built a thriving private practice, doing the exact work she feels she was put on this earth to do. Leah believes that the work involved with unraveling years of conditioning in diet culture and learning to come home to one’s body is deeply spiritual work and she treats it as such. She currently lives in Northern California with her partner and their two kitties.
